#clone(path, target = nil) ⇒ Object
copies directories and files from the real filesystem into our fake one
64 65 66 67 68 69 70 71 72 73 74 75 76 77 78 79 80 81 82 83 84 85 86 87 |
# File 'lib/fakefs/file_system.rb', line 64 def clone(path, target = nil) path = RealFile.(path) pattern = File.join(path, '**', '*') files = if RealFile.file?(path) [path] else [path] + RealDir.glob(pattern, RealFile::FNM_DOTMATCH) end files.each do |f| target_path = target ? f.gsub(path, target) : f if RealFile.symlink?(f) FileUtils.ln_s(RealFile.readlink(f), f) elsif RealFile.file?(f) FileUtils.mkdir_p(File.dirname(f)) File.open(target_path, File::WRITE_ONLY) do |g| g.print RealFile.read(f) end elsif RealFile.directory?(f) FileUtils.mkdir_p(target_path) end end end |

#find(path, dir: nil) ⇒ Object
Finds files/directories using the exact path, without expanding globs.
24 25 26 27 28 29 |
# File 'lib/fakefs/file_system.rb', line 24 def find(path, dir: nil) parts = path_parts(normalize_path(path, dir: dir)) return fs if parts.empty? # '/' find_recurser(fs, parts) end |
#find_with_glob(path, find_flags = 0, gave_char_class = false, dir: nil) ⇒ Object
Finds files/directories expanding globs.
32 33 34 35 36 37 38 39 40 41 42 43 44 45 46 |
# File 'lib/fakefs/file_system.rb', line 32 def find_with_glob(path, find_flags = 0, gave_char_class = false, dir: nil) parts = path_parts(normalize_path(path, dir: dir)) return fs if parts.empty? # '/' entries = Globber.(path).flat_map do |pattern| parts = path_parts(normalize_path(pattern, dir: dir)) find_with_glob_recurser(fs, parts, find_flags, gave_char_class).flatten end case entries.length when 0 then nil when 1 then entries.first else entries end end |

#normalize_path(path, dir: nil) ⇒ Object
112 113 114 115 116 117 118 119 120 121 122 123 |
# File 'lib/fakefs/file_system.rb', line 112 def normalize_path(path, dir: nil) if Pathname.new(path).absolute? RealFile.(path) else dir ||= dir_levels dir = Array(dir) parts = dir + [path] RealFile.(parts.reduce do |base, part| Pathname(base) + part end.to_s) end end |
